tour details

Discover the typical countryside of Central Vietnam far from any tourist areas by bike and boat with introduction to a green farming collective run by young locals

08:00 hrs: Pick up at hotel lobby and transfer to the village of Go Noi located 15 km west of Hoi An. Upon arrival, meet with Phap, who is part of the collective that started organic vegetable farming. Have a look around their house, then start to cycle through the village and the rice fields.
Arrival at the organic plantation comprised of chilli peppers, water bindweed, salad, basilica, spinach, squash and edible chrysanthemums, you can try some agricultural work such as vegetable harvesting, planting, weeding, tilling the soil, watering or fertilizing crops with organic compost.
Continue cycling to a small pier at the Thu Bon River and board a local boat. After 10 minutes of crossing, you will arrive at the pumpkin and watermelon farm belonging to the collective. They are grown in sand at the edge of the river. Depending on the season, harvest a pumpkin or watermelon (to eat it later) and return by boat to the pier.
During the ride back to Mr. Phap’s house, visit a wood carving workshop. Enjoy a small try to have a better understanding about this beautiful handicraft. Back at Mr Phap’s house, have lunch with the family in a typical and authentic atmosphere.
Optional: preparation of a typical dish the” banh xeo”.
Notes:
o The wood carving workshop is closed every Sunday, the 1st of September, the 30th of April, 1st of May and Tet vacation -> this activity will be replaced by the preparation of the banh xeo
o For the month of October, November and December, the local boat tour and the harvest of pumpkin/watermelon will be replaced by the preparation of the banh xeo
